New Horizons Holidays launches Dubai program for 2012
More tours, hotels and unique experiences
27 October, 2011: New Horizons Holidays has unveiled its 2012 Dubai program, including Oman and Abu Dhabi, its most extensive range across the region to date.
The new program equips travel agents with the perfect selling tool, brochuring the latest and the best accommodation, sightseeing and touring options accommodating the diverse needs and holiday desires of West Australian travellers.
Chris Evans, Managing Director, New Horizons Holidays, said, “Once purely a hub for stopovers, Dubai and the Arabian Peninsula is becoming increasingly popular as a holiday destination in its own right with the average stay increasing from three to four nights, to six or seven.
“On the back of strong growth, with a 30 per cent increase in sales over the last 12 months for Dubai, Abu Dhabi and Oman, we’ve extended our program to accommodate the changing needs of travellers and to offer repeat visitors exciting new choices.
“The expanded program boasts 16 new hotel options including the impressive five-star Crowne Plaza Dubai Festival City, four-star Ascot Hotel and the three-star Belvedere Court Hotel Apartments.
“New Horizon Holidays is also thrilled to introduce A New World of Wonders – Atlantis’ Aquaventure and Lost Chamber, to our sightseeing program. It’s a fantastic family experience showcasing 65,000 marine animals, water rapids, rollercoaster and even a submerged waterslide through shark-infested waters. We’ve also brochured Ferrari World Abu Dhabi, which is designed to bring to life the fascinating story of Ferrari.
“We expect both new tours to sell strongly next year, in addition to existing product such as Dubai’sSundowner Dune Dinner Safari which gives travellers a chance to experience the magic of Arabia and a taste of traditional Bedouin hospitality on a four wheel-driving experience in the desert.”
